Why We Have Stopped Being A Representative Constitutional Republic
The truth of the matter is this. The United States – even though it exists as such on paper – is not a representative constitutional republic and we sure as hell aren’t a democracy. Yes, we have elections to elect our representatives who are then tasked with legislating and executing the laws of the land, but that process ends at the election. The federal government is not currently structured to have fidelity to the Constitution of the Bill of Rights.
With the codification of the 17th Amendment, the United States ceased being the nation our Framers created for us. Gone was the protection of State sovereignty; the protection of state's rights from a power-hungry federal government. While the US House of Representatives was always supposed to be “the peoples’ house” (the chamber of the federal government that directly represented the American people individually), the US Senate was designed to represent the states in the federal government. It was, for this reason, that the two US Senators seated from each state were to be appointed by the state legislatures. The House represented the people, the Senate represented the states, and a symbiotic check-and-balance against despotism at the hands of both the federal government and the national political parties was in place.
